A rare Wedgwood wine cooler
early 19th century
in the terracotta or 'orange' body, with twin handles and a cylindrical neck decorated with fruiting vine, moulded after the Antique with scantily draped classical figures, frolicking below drapery suspended from tree branches, 25.3cm high, impressed WEDGWOOD (some surface degradation)
